[QUOTE=hhcheese;19504411]Its Not a sea knight, that my friend would be a Chinook. :)[/QUOTE] No, my friend, it's a CH46 Sea Knight, not a CH47 Chinook. [b]Sea Knight:[/b] [media]http://www.military-aircraft.org.uk/helicopters/CH-46%20Sea%20Knight.jpg[/media] [b]Chinook:[/b] [media]http://www.enemyforces.net/helicopters/ch47_chinook.jpg[/media] The Chinook is [i]much[/i] bigger than the Sea Knight and is clearly distinguishable by it's engines near the rear tailplane, longer sponsons containing fuel and four landing-gear, as opposed to the Sea Knight's lack of tailplane engines, small sponsons containing rear landing-gear and only three landing-gear.
